Last term on Thursday of Week 10, the SVT hosted our first Footy Colours Day to raise school spirit, celebrate community and raise money for the Fight Cancer Foundation. We successfully raised $500 to donate on behalf of our school community.
Students proudly wore their team colours and enjoyed a fantastic afternoon featuring a BBQ, live music courtesy of our talented staff and students, face-painting, and 9-square in the quad.
The highlight of the day was the highly anticipated staff vs student touch football game – a close match that ended with the staff team taking the win 3–2! A huge thank you to all staff and students who participated and supported the event, helping make it such a success.




















































The GRIP Student Leadership Conference is held anually all around the country and our SVT members have been fortunate enough to attend. It concentrates specifically on training student leaders for their role as school leaders, focussing on being an active member of the school community right now!
Students who attended came away with new skills, new perspectives and new ideas for making a positive contribution to their community as a leader and spent the day making connections with like minded people from schools all across the Hunter Reigon!
Students identified specific challenges at our school that the SVT hope to address, and brainstormed ways to achieve this and get their ideas off the ground.
Developing personal leadership skills are important too and the students were able to select electives such as: Improving my Public Speaking and Creating a Culture of Positive Friendships to round out the day.
We look forward to bringing these initiatives forward to the student body and making some positive change at FGHS!
